جک می خواهد یک الگوی Normal بسازد که یک پاورقی با نام فایل و مسیر فایل در آن باشد. او این کار را با افزودن فیلدهایی به پاورقی انجام می دهد. به نظر می رسد جک نمی تواند مسیر را در آن پیدا کند، حتی پس از علامت زدن کادر مناسب هنگام درج فیلد. به نظر جک، کاربر باید فیلدها را به صورت دستی در پاورقی یک سند جدید وارد کند.
از توضیحات او به نظر می رسد که جک می داند چگونه کدهای فیلد را در پاورقی قالب خود وارد کند. بنابراین، به جای ارائه مراحل انجام این کار در اینجا، فقط به این نکته اشاره می کنم که کد فیلد واقعی باید بسیار شبیه به این باشد:
{ FILENAME p * MERGEFORMAT }
سوئیچ فیلد (یا اگر ترجیح می دهید، گزینه فیلد) که باعث می شود مسیر با نام فایل اضافه شود، سوئیچ p است.
اگر کد فیلد شما شبیه این است یا بسیار شبیه به این است، قدم بعدی این است که ببینید Word چگونه با فیلدها رفتار می کند. این بسیار مهم است زیرا فیلدها، در مورد جک، بخشی از یک الگو هستند. هنگامی که یک سند جدید بر اساس آن الگو ایجاد می کنید، واضح است که سند هنوز ذخیره نشده است - کاملاً جدید است. بنابراین، هیچ نام فایل یا مسیری برای بازگشت کد فیلد وجود ندارد. بنابراین، میروید و این سند جدید را ذخیره میکنید، و اکنون یک نام فایل و مسیر دارید، بنابراین فکر میکنید که کد فیلد در فوتر بهروزرسانی میشود تا آن اطلاعات را منعکس کند.
اما اینطور نیست. چرا که نه؟ زیرا Word فیلدها را به طور خودکار به روز نمی کند. تنها یک بار وجود دارد که میتوانید روی بهروزرسانی خودکار آنها حساب کنید، و آن زمانی است که انتخاب میکنید سند را چاپ کنید. این کار را انجام دهید و نام فایل و مسیر در فوتر باید به روز شود. یا، اگر ترجیح می دهید، فقط از قابلیت های چاپ پیش نمایش Word استفاده کنید تا Word را فریب دهید تا فکر کند در حال چاپ هستید و اطلاعات باید به روز شوند.
البته، میتوانید Word را «اجبار» کنید تا اطلاعات موجود در فوتر را بهروزرسانی کند. دو راه برای انجام این کار وجود دارد. یکی این است که به پاورقی بروید و کد فیلد را دوباره قرار دهید. این همان چیزی است که به نظر می رسد جک در مورد آن صحبت می کند و با انجام این کار Word را مجبور می کند تا اطلاعات (نام فایل و مسیر) را بگیرد و آن را به جای کد فیلد تازه درج شده نمایش دهد. راه دیگری که می توانید این کار را انجام دهید این است که به پاورقی بروید، کد فیلد را انتخاب کنید و F9 را فشار دهید تا Word مجبور شود آنچه را که نمایش داده می شود به روز کند. البته، هر دوی این روشها برای اجبار بهروزرسانی باید پس از ذخیره اولیه سند جدید انجام شوند - فقط در آن نقطه است که نام فایل و مسیر در دسترس است.
راههایی برای حل این وضعیت وجود دارد، و به جای تکرار آنها در اینجا، خوانندگان را به نکته زیر راهنمایی میکنم که تعداد زیادی از رویکردها را ارائه میکند:
در مورد نام مسیری که توسط کد فیلد برگردانده میشود یک هشدار وجود دارد که باید به خاطر بسپارید: اگر سند در OneDrive ذخیره میشود، مسیر بهجای مسیری به فایل همگامسازیشده در درایو محلی شما بهعنوان یک URL نشان داده میشود. بنابراین، اگر از OneDrive استفاده می کنید، ممکن است نتایج مورد نظر خود را از کد فیلد دریافت نکنید.